Re: Canadian Student Visa Thread Part 14 by aybee4991: 9:21am On Jun 22, 2018
Mbaku86:
I received a Medical request on the 8th of June, 2018. Afterwards, i did my Medicals on the 11th and the Hospital confirmed they sent my report. But on my portal no update so far on the medical status. It is still showing that they have requested a Medical. Is the status on medical not supposed to have been updated by now?
the same thing happened to me. don't just wait for it to be updated. first, call the hospital to be sure your medical report was sent, then ask them for a proof of submission.
Then send a case-specific enquiry with your proof of submission and datapage of your passport attached.
I did my medicals on may the 28th, and the hospital somehow didn't upload the results until I followed up.

Re: Canadian Student Visa Thread Part 14 by mcobex: 1:54pm On Jun 22, 2018
123abcclown:


Can someone please comment on this. kiss
I don't think the cheque will be accepted, but the good news is that he has paid your tuition fee. Let him write in his letter of support that he has paid your tuition fee and will transfer the living expenses to you later. You also need to state it in your SOP that he has paid your tuition. He needs to show his proof of funds(business or any other way he makes his money).
NB:Make sure you submit your own SOA as well(no matter how small the money in it is). Best of luck
